How much do evening personal ass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for evening personal assistant in Decatur, GA is $22.62,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.20 and $25.34 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an evening personal assistant?

Evening personal assistants are professionals who provide support and assistance to individuals or households during the evening hours. Their duties can include organizing schedules, running errands, preparing meals, assisting with personal tasks, or providing companionship. Some may also help with childcare, housekeeping, or coordinating appointments. These assistants often work for busy professionals, families, or individuals who need extra help after regular business hours. Their role is tailored to the specific needs of their employer, ensuring that daily routines run smoothly in the evening.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an evening personal assistant?

To thrive as an Evening Personal Assistant, you need excellent organizational skills, attention to detail, and prior experience in administrative or personal support roles. Familiarity with scheduling software, communication tools, and possibly a valid driver's license are commonly required. Outstanding interpersonal skills, discretion, and reliability help you build trust and effectively support your employer’s needs during evening hours. These abilities ensure seamless task management, confidentiality, and high-quality assistance, which are crucial for the smooth running of your employer’s personal and professional life.

What are some common challenges faced by evening personal assistants, and how can applicants prepare for them?

Evening Personal Assistants often face challenges such as balancing last-minute requests, managing multiple priorities after standard business hours, and maintaining clear communication with clients who may have demanding schedules. To prepare, applicants should demonstrate strong organizational skills, flexibility, and the ability to remain calm under pressure. Familiarity with digital tools for scheduling and communication, as well as proactive time management, can help ensure tasks are completed efficiently in a dynamic environment.

What is the difference between Evening Personal Assistant vs Part-Time Personal Assistant?

AspectEvening Personal AssistantPart-Time Personal Assistant
Work HoursPrimarily evening hours, often after standard workdayFlexible hours, including mornings, afternoons, or evenings
CredentialsRelevant experience, sometimes certifications in personal care or administrationSimilar credentials, depending on tasks
Work EnvironmentPrivate homes, client residencesPrivate homes, offices, or remote
Industry UsageCommon in personal and household support rolesUsed across personal, administrative, and support roles

The main difference is that an Evening Personal Assistant primarily works during evening hours, focusing on personal or household tasks, while a Part-Time Personal Assistant offers more flexible hours across different times of the day. Both roles require similar skills and credentials but differ mainly in scheduling and specific duties.
